The Queen's BioMechatronics Team (QBMeT) is a multidisciplinary team that designs and manufactures wearable bionic systems to improve the human body by analyzing and enhancing human motions. The prototypes are designed for use in nearly any industry or application including construction, medicine, and emergency services.

The Power Systems Team within QBMeT focuses on the design, testing, and integration of electrical and energy systems that power the wearable bionic devices. Project Managers overseeing this team will ensure that prototypes are developed using precise electrical schematics and optimized power distribution methods, incorporating battery systems, energy harvesting techniques, and efficient circuitry for maximum performance. They will be responsible for coordinating the integration of power systems with other subsystems, troubleshooting electrical issues, and ensuring that all designs meet the necessary safety, efficiency, and ergonomic requirements. Additionally, they will work closely with the team to validate that the power systems align with the overall project goals and performance standards.
